Output 75b59ce903fb4e2a403f516e4ef8ecf1b49672d0c8cfc2d66d65e97bd2889788:2

value
14967782
script pubkey
OP_0 OP_PUSHBYTES_20 ecf717d3102395f944e78da6926c30d6bac03e87
address
bc1qanm305csyw2lj3883knfymps66avq058tz074d
transaction
75b59ce903fb4e2a403f516e4ef8ecf1b49672d0c8cfc2d66d65e97bd2889788